When the pressure inside the tank is greater than atmospheric pressure, the gauge reports a positive value. Vacuum gauges are devices for measuring gas pressures from just above to well below atmospheric pressure (din 28 400, part 3, 1992 issue). For example, many physics experiments must take place in a vacuum chamber, a rigid chamber from which some of the air is pumped out. The typical absolute pressure range for measuring vacuum pressures is 0 to 1 bar absolute. Some gauges are designed to measure negative pressure.
